Tomas Costanza first came into the public eye as the lead singer and guitar player for a group called Diffuser. This was, you know, his initial step into the music world, where he began to show his creative abilities. Born in Massapequa, New York, he carried that early experience forward into a significant career as a record maker, a person who writes songs, and the head of Killingsworth Recording Company. This company has locations in both Los Angeles and New York, which tells you a little about the scope of his operations. Tomas Costanza's first big step into the music scene was with his band, Diffuser. He was the lead singer and the person who wrote the songs for the group, which is where he really began to get noticed. This period was quite significant for him, as it set the stage for everything that came after. It's where he honed his skills as a performer and a writer, developing the foundation for his later work in production and composition. So, this early experience was, you know, very important for his path.

The band, Diffuser, signed a deal with Hollywood Records back in 2000, which was a pretty big accomplishment at the time. This kind of agreement helps a band reach a much wider audience. Beyond just putting out albums, several of Diffuser's songs found their way into different movies. This meant their music was heard by even more people, giving them exposure in a unique way. Tomas Costanza has a notable history of creating music for films, which is a very specific kind of writing. His work as a songwriter includes contributions to movie soundtracks that have been quite popular. For instance, he has credits on films like "Freaky Friday," "Confessions of a Teenage Drama Queen," "Summer Catch," and even "Mission Impossible II." These are, you know, pretty well-known movies, and his involvement means his music has been heard by millions.

The collective sales of these soundtracks are pretty impressive, reaching over 4.2 million copies across the globe, according to R.I.A.A. figures. If you're wondering where Tomas Costanza's creative output shows up, it's pretty widespread. His music isn't just in movies or on albums; it also gets used in advertisements and promotional materials for some very big names. He has what are called "synch credits," meaning his music has been synchronized with visuals for brands like Apple, Galaxy, Ford, Google, Amazon, Target, TJ Maxx, Zillow, and Tropicana. One particularly interesting collaboration involves Drag Race star Alaska and Ashley Gordon. Together with Justin Andrew Honard, they created a musical, with Tomas Costanza contributing to the book, music, and lyrics. This project, which tells a story through music, saw its studio album come out on May 13th, and the cast recording of "The Musical Live" was released on April 25th through Peg Records/Warner. This really shows his willingness to explore different creative avenues, even something as specific as a drag musical. It's pretty cool, in a way.

The musical production also brought in other creative people, like Paul Coultrup, who was responsible for the music and sound design.
